The Origin and Meaning of Jaquez
Let’s start at the beginning. Jaquez is primarily recognized as a Spanish name, often considered a variant of the French 'Jacques,' which itself is the French form of 'James.' The name James has deep biblical roots, originating from the Hebrew 'Yaakov,' meaning 'supplanter' or 'one who follows.' This etymology hints at qualities of leadership and resilience, suggesting a person who overcomes challenges or takes initiative.
Though Jaquez’s exact origin is sometimes labeled as 'unknown' in broader databases, the linguistic trail points firmly toward its Hispanic and French connections. What’s beautiful here is how the name bridges cultures, carrying with it stories from Europe to the Americas.
